Training Questions Regarding Young Athletes

Training Questions Regarding Young Athletes

I'm amazed at how many people train kids like they are Olympic level athletes who need some advanced programming/training.  It is also equally obnoxious to train them like they are elderly or made of glass, having entire workouts of pre-hab, rehab and balance work.  If you are an athlete who hasn't mastered basic calisthenics, running and bodyweight movements, you better build your base before you try to touch the clouds.  No base = no foundation.  And a proper foundation isn't built on a Bosu.
